    Abstract: Provided are methods, systems, and apparatuses for detecting, processing, and responding to audio signals, including speech signals, within a designated area or space. A platform for multiple media devices connected via a network is configured to process speech, such as voice commands, detected at the media devices, and respond to the detected speech by causing the media devices to simultaneously perform one or more requested actions. The platform is capable of scoring the quality of a speech request, handling speech requests from multiple end points of the platform using a centralized processing approach, a de-centralized processing approach, or a combination thereof, and also manipulating partial processing of speech requests from multiple end points into a coherent whole when necessary.

    Abstract: Provided is a platform for data devices in which the architecture and runtime parameters of the platform are adaptively updated based on real-time data collected about a network on which the platform operates, the source type (e.g., codec selection) for data being communicated between devices, the grouping/architecture of the devices, or any combination thereof. The platform is thus able to support multiple different types and configurations of data devices under varied, constantly-changing conditions. The platform offers a flexible architecture for a content management and rendering system in which multiple data devices connected via the network each play a unique role in the operation of the system. The data devices are capable of dynamically switching between different roles while the system is in active operation. The platform also includes adaptive delay capabilities as well as adaptive codec selection capabilities.
